Entrance hall


Radiator, staircase to first floor, tiled flooring
Downstairs cloaks/WC


Hand washbasin, low level WC with push button cistern, radiator, double glazed window, tiled flooring

lounge 14’0 (4.27m) x 11’11(3.63m)

Radiator, double glazed window to front, under-stair cupboard, tiled flooring

dining kitchen 15’0 (4.57m) x 8’10 (2.69m)

Fabulous family dining kitchen incorporating a range of base, wall and drawer units, worktops, integrated electric oven, electric hob, single drainer sink unit with hot and cold mixer taps, double glazed French doors to the rear garden, radiator, combination boiler, integrated fridge and freezer, integrated dishwasher, double glazed window to rear, tiled flooring
First floor landing


Loft access, large storage cupboard

bedroom one 11’10 (3.61m) x 9’1 (2.77m),

Radiator, double glazed window to front
En suite shower room


Contemporary En-suite comprising of shower cubicle, double glazed window, radiator, double glazed window

bedroom two 9’0 (2.74m) x 7’1 (2.16m)

Radiator, double glazed window to rear

bedroom three 7’07 (2.16m) x 5’10 (1.79m)

Radiator, double glazed window to rear
Bathroom


Stylish and well-presented family bathroom comprising of bath with mixer taps, pedestal washbasin with mixer taps, low level WC with push button cistern, tiled splash backs, extractor, flooring, radiator
Externally


Lovely, enclosed rear garden with a South Easterly aspect, patio, lawn, shed and side path providing access to the front of the property, driveway
